AAA: Michigan Gas Prices Drop to Lowest Since 2021

The Michigan state average dropped 13 cents from a week ago Gas prices in Michigan are down 13 cents from last week. Michigan drivers are now paying an average of $2.79 per gallon for regular unleaded, which is a new 2025-low. This price is 41 cents less than this time last month and 49 cents less than this time last year. Motorists are paying … Read more

FDA Recall: Jody’s Sea Salt Caramel Popcorn (n8n)

Consumers across the United States should be aware of recent recalls that could impact their health and safety. Jody’s Inc. has issued a recall for its Cabot Creamery Sea Salt Caramel Cheddar Popcorn due to undeclared peanuts, which pose a serious risk to individuals with peanut allergies.
